Abstract:
The present invention relates to a system and method for preserving and identifying recency information for data stored in multiple mirrored memory locations in a redundant data storage mechanism. The inventive approach builds upon the benefits presented by redundant storage by appending an indication of storage recency to stored data, thereby enabling a future read operation to identify a degree of recency for data stored in each of a plurality of mirrored sites. The read operation will generally return only the most recently stored data found among the plurality of mirrored locations.
